What this means

This registration is in, or will soon enter, a USPTO maintenance window. Missing a Section 8 or Section 9 filing can cancel the registration.

Status 800: Status 800 means the registration was renewed after acceptable combined Section 8 and Section 9 filings. The mark remains registered for another 10-year term with active federal protection.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
009CASES, ALBUMS, BAGS, [ STORAGE TRAYS, ] POCKETS, AND SLEEVES FOR COMPACT DISCS, [ COMPACT DISC PLAYERS, ] BLANK DVDS, PRE-RECORDED DVDS, DVD PLAYERS, BLANK DIGITAL DISKS, PRE-RECORDED DIGITAL DISKS, [ DIGITAL MEDIA PLAYERS, MP3 PLAYERS, ] VIDEO GAME DISCS, COMPUTER GAME DISCS, PERSONAL ORGANIZERS, COMPUTERS, BLANK CD-ROMS, PRE-RECORDED CD-ROMS, [ BLANK FLOPPY DISCS, PRE-RECORDED FLOPPY DISCS, ] DIGITAL STORAGE DEVICES, namely, HARD DRIVES FOR COMPUTERS, JUMP DRIVES, NAMELY, USB DRIVES, [ BLANK VIDEOCASSETTES, PRE-RECORDED VIDEOCASSETTES, ] CAMERAS AND CAMCORDERS; WRITABLE MEDIA KITS COMPRISING CASES AND WALLETS FOR COMPACT DISCS AND DVDS AND WRITABLE COMPACT DISCS OR WRITABLE DVDS; [ STORAGE CABINETS AND RACKS FOR COMPACT DISCS, DVDS, DIGITAL MEDIA, VIDEOCASSETTES, GAME DISCS, CD-ROMS, AND FLOPPY DISCS ]ACTIVE
012[ VEHICLE AND BOAT CARGO BAGS AND CASES; VEHICLE AND BOAT TRUNK 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ES; VEHICLE AND BOAT GLOVE COMPARTMENT 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ES; ] VEHICLE AND BOAT CONSOLE AND DOOR 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ES; VEHICLE AND BOAT VISOR 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ES; VEHICLE AND BOAT FRONT SEAT AND BACK SEAT 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ES [ ; 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ES THAT ATTACH TO A VEHICLE OR BOAT SEAT; VEHICLE AND BOAT TRASH BAGS, NAMELY, REUSABLE TRASH CONTAINERS FOR USE IN VEHICLES AND BOATS; VEHICLE AND BOAT ORGANIZATIONAL PRODUCTS, NAMELY, DOCUMENT HOLDERS, ORGANIZER POUCHES AND CASES ATTACHED TO SEAT BELTS OR AIR VENTS; WHEELCHAIR, SCOOTER AND STROLLER ACCESSORIES, NAMELY, LAP ORGANIZERS, UNDER SEAT ORGANIZERS, AND CATCHALLS, ALL MADE OF MESH, CANVAS, POLYESTER, NYLON OR LEATHER ]ACTIVE
018LUGGAGE, NAMELY, DUFFEL BAGS, ROLLING DUFFEL BAGS, WHEELED UPRIGHT BAGS, BACK PACKS, SHOULDER BAGS, AND BRIEFCASES; CARRYING CASES, NAMELY, ORGANIZER BAGS AND CASES FOR PORTABLE VIDEO AND DVD SYSTEMS FOR USE IN A LAND OR MARINE VEHICLE [ ; WALLETS; BILLFOLDS; BRIEFCASE-TYPE PORTFOLIOS; TOOL ORGANIZERS, NAMELY, TOOL POUCHES, SOLD EMPTY ]ACTIVE
